    Kathryn Schulz: A Beacon of Insight in Journalism

    Kathryn Schulz, an esteemed American journalist and author, has carved a niche for herself in the realm of literary journalism with her profound and insightful works. As a staff writer for The New Yorker, Schulz has penned numerous articles that delve deep into a wide array of subjects, showcasing her versatility and depth of understanding. Her noteworthy achievements, including winning the Pulitzer Prize, underscore her prowess and significant contributions to journalism and literature.

    The Journey to Pulitzer Glory

    Schulz’s journey to the pinnacle of journalistic recognition, the Pulitzer Prize, was marked by her groundbreaking article, “The Really Big One.” This piece explored the seismic risks in the Pacific Northwest, bringing to light the potential for a catastrophic earthquake and its implications. Her ability to dissect complex scientific information and present it in a compelling, accessible manner not only garnered widespread acclaim but also raised awareness about a critical issue, demonstrating the power of journalism to influence public discourse and policy.

    From “Losing Streak” to “Lost & Found”

    The genesis of Schulz’s second book, “Lost & Found,” can be traced back to her New Yorker article “Losing Streak.” This narrative, which was later included in The Best American Essays collection, showcases Schulz’s ability to weave personal anecdotes with broader philosophical inquiries, exploring themes of loss, discovery, and the human condition. Her essays are a testament to her skill in navigating the complexities of the heart and mind, inviting readers to reflect on their own experiences and perceptions.

    A Voice that Resonates Across Genres

    Schulz’s contributions extend beyond her Pulitzer-winning piece. Her works have been featured in esteemed collections such as The Best American Science and Nature Writing, The Best American Travel Writing, and The Best American Food Writing. These inclusions highlight her adaptability and the universal appeal of her writing. Whether she’s exploring the intricacies of science, the nuances of travel, or the delights of food, Schulz’s prose resonates with a broad audience, showcasing her ability to illuminate the beauty and intricacies of the world around us.

    Personal Life and Inspirations

    Hailing from Ohio, Schulz’s roots are deeply embedded in the American heartland, which has influenced her perspectives and writing. Currently residing on Maryland’s Eastern Shore with her family, she draws inspiration from her surroundings and personal experiences, infusing her work with authenticity and depth. Her writing not only reflects her keen observational skills but also her commitment to exploring the complexities of life and the myriad ways in which the personal intersects with the universal.
